Legal Aid For Other Vulnerable Populations

Legal aid for other vulnerable populations refers to the provision of legal assistance and support to individuals or groups who may face significant barriers in accessing justice due to their vulnerable status.

Key Features

  • Access to legal advice and representation
  • Assistance with navigating the legal system
  • Advocacy for the rights of vulnerable populations

Pros

  • Ensures equal access to justice for all individuals
  • Helps protect the rights of vulnerable populations
  • Promotes social justice and equality

Cons

  • Limited availability and resources for providing legal aid
  • Challenges in reaching all vulnerable populations in need
